Vladimir B. Balakirsky† and Anahit R. Ghazaryan, State University of Aerospace Instrumentation, St-Petersburg, Russia
We propose a network-type scheme of private information retrieval, presented as a modification of the conventional setup, where the user is replaced with two users, the user-sender and the user-receiver. As a result of communication, the user-receiver becomes informed about the bit located at a certain position of the database, owned by the servers. Each server receives a query from the user-sender that contains information about the position in a hidden form and the server cannot disclose this position.
